Output 17bd303722eaf532c1d2348f21cfab62c927242427606fa20a94898f2d8ec9fb:1

value
70869051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c48b598eceee2ddeff25a5b9574d5554d87055 OP_EQUAL
address
M9tFsbfSgevHTStWmMYNErQSUMye2eiULz
transaction
17bd303722eaf532c1d2348f21cfab62c927242427606fa20a94898f2d8ec9fb
spent
true